A Glimpse into the Disco Era
The 1970s were marked by a remarkable fusion of music, dance, and fashion. The disco movement emerged as a celebration of liberation and self-expression, characterized by its pulsating beats, energetic dance floors, and extravagant outfits. Discotheques, such as Studio 54 in New York City, became the epicenter of this cultural revolution. These venues welcomed a diverse crowd of partygoers, including celebrities, artists, and everyday people, all seeking an escape from the mundane and a taste of the glamorous disco lifestyle.
The disco era embraced diversity, promoting a spirit of inclusivity that transcended race, gender, and sexual orientation. In this atmosphere of acceptance and exuberance, fashion played a crucial role in enabling self-expression and individuality. It was a time when people dressed to impress, with flamboyant and glittering outfits that embodied the spirit of disco.
